    What about trading your car in for something like a Prius with a factory fitted one? There's a lot of them around now.
    I picked up a Prius a little over a year ago with one. Didn't particularly want it, but it just so happened the model I saw had it. It is a fantastic aid. The automatic parking is just a gimmick and a waste of time, but the camera, with it's overlay lines of where the car will go is really useful once you get the confidence to use it. I now park without looking back, but do still glance in the mirrors!
    I would think fitting an aftermarket one would be disappointing if you've seen the factory ones. Plus, as already noted, you need a screen somewhere, which will be assumed to be a desirable sat-nav if left in view.

    Changing car to get a reversing camera seems a bit drastic lol. To answer the other question there are plenty if all in. One kits with camera screen and cabling on ebay, check the reviews before buying. Don't bother with the wireless cameras the picture quality tends to be terrible and some have to be mounted inside the car
